Creating Pages
Add new pages and organize them into folders.
Create a new page
When you add a page, you’ll choose:
- Page name (what you see in the editor)
- URL path (what visitors see in the browser)
Tip: keep URLs short and readable (for example, /about, /services, /contact).
Choose how to start
After you create a page, you can begin with:
- Continue with Blank Page: start from scratch.
- Choose a Template: start from a prebuilt layout.
- AI Generate: describe the page and let AI build a first draft.
AI Generate options
When using AI Generate, you can control the starting direction:
- Prompt: describe audience, offer, visual style, and anything to avoid.
- Use current branding: keeps your current global style direction.
- Let AI propose a fresh brand direction: creates a draft global Brand Kit you can review in preview before applying.
- Improved row matching: section generation now distinguishes row template groups like Headers, Heroes, and Footers for more precise layout picks.
If a generation includes a Brand Kit draft, it is applied when you apply the generated page.
Steps
1
Open Manage Pages
Go to Website Pages.
2
Select Add Page
Choose Add Page.
3
Enter a page name
Use Page name. A slug is created for you.
4
(Optional) Adjust slug or folder
Select the settings icon to edit Slug or choose a Folder.
5
Pick a starting option
Choose Blank Page, Template, or AI Generate.
Tips
- Keep page names short and clear.
- If a slug is already taken, rename the page.
- Use folders to keep large sites organized.
- After page creation, configure metadata in Page Settings and validate breakpoints in Responsive Design.
